Abstract
The utility model discloses a baby stroller either for one infant or for two infants. The baby stroller comprises a front support assembly, a front wheel assembly, a push rod assembly, a rear support assembly connected with the push rod assembly in a rotating mode, and seat bag assemblies. A bottom support assembly which is telescopic in the front and back direction is arranged between the front support assembly and the rear support assembly and comprises a slide tube with the front end connected with the front support assembly, and a bottom supporting tube with the rear end connected with the rear support assembly. The slide tube is arranged in the bottom supporting tube in a penetrating mode and connected with the bottom supporting tube in a sliding mode. The front portion of the bottom supporting tube is provided with a locking mechanism which is used for locking the slide tube when the slide tube is in the draw-back state and the stretch-out state. The lower end of the push rod assembly is connected with the rear support assembly in a rotating mode through a rotating joint. The front support assembly upwards extends to form a seat bag insertion rod. The two seat bag assemblies can be fixedly connected with the seat bag insertion rod and the rotating joint in an inserted mode respectively. The baby stroller can provide seats for two infants, and can also be adjusted on the aspect of seating according to use demands, and conversion operation is quite convenient.
